Taking care of the things you own.

Image via Flickr

It can be easy to take things for granted, be it a car, a computer, furniture, or even just a pair of shoes, but respecting your things is a huge marker of growing up. Some things are easy to take care of, but others require time, effort, and research. When was the last time you changed the oil in your car? Or rotated the tires? Even just keeping your things clean can add years of use!
